Handover Note — Large-Deal Discounting

From outgoing director Pell Arneson to Dara Quist, for circulation to branch managers. Current policy: standard floor is 12% off list on the Vexley range; deals over the enterprise threshold may reach 20% with my (now your) sign-off. Three open exceptions pending — see the tracker. Watch the Marrowgate branch; they discount early and often. Approval turnaround target is 48 hours. Forward-looking direction on pricing is captured in the note below.

management briefing: Project Ulavan slips by two quarters because of the staffing delay.

## Changelog — Wavelatch 3.2: reconnect defaults changed

We fixed a long-standing websocket reconnect bug in Wavelatch where clients dropped by the Norvik edge proxy retried immediately with no backoff, creating thundering-herd spikes. The default reconnect policy is now exponential backoff with jitter, capped at 30 seconds, and the handshake timeout was raised to tolerate slow upgrades. New team members should read the retry design doc before tuning these. The new default configuration values are shown below.

service settings:
PRAIX_LOG_LEVEL=error
PRAIX_METRICS_HOST=metrics.praix.qorvelcorp.corp
PRAIX_POOL_SIZE=16

# shrinkray CLI — environment configuration
#
# shrinkray resizes image batches against the RasterMill processing
# grid. Most options are passed as flags, but credentials live here
# so they never end up in shell history or job logs. Maintainers:
# this file is gitignored on purpose; keep it that way, and rotate
# the grid credential whenever a maintainer leaves the project.
# The line below grants shrinkray access to the processing grid.

vault entry, yahif-yajep: COURIER_KEY29=b802bdf8034096b65a51c6ba5abe2

MEMO — Harkady Appliances
To: Sales Leads
Re: Warranty-cost overrun, Breezeline dryer series

Warranty claims on the Breezeline series ran 22% over budget this quarter, driven by drum-bearing failures in units built at the Norlow plant. A revised component supplier is in place as of this month. Expect customer escalations to taper by next quarter. Please hold off on extended-warranty promotions until further notice. Guidance on positioning follows below.

confidential, hahop-bajep: Gross margin on Ralath came in at 5 percent against a plan of 10 percent. Only 9 of the 100 pilot accounts renewed Ralath, so a churn review is set for April 1.